King’s Fork extends 757 reign, secures state tourney trip

- Staff reports

Class 4 Region A Tournament King’s Fork 76, Great Bridge 45:

Sam Brannen led five double-figure scorers with 17 points, and the top-seeded Bulldogs raced to a 24-point halftime lead in a semifinal victory in Suffolk that clinched a state tournament berth.

King’s Fork (20-3) remained unbeaten against Hampton Roads opponents, racing to a 49-25 lead at halftime. Brannen finished with seven assists and Kaleb Brown (11 points, six rebounds, four assists), Adarius Boston (13 points, six rebounds), Zekhi Darden (10 points) and Elijah Walker (10 points) also scored in double figures.

The Bulldogs will host Heritage in tonight’s region championsh­ip game.

Heritage 62, Hampton 51: The Hurricanes earned a state tournament berth under first-year coach Dimitri Batten, a former player for Kecoughtan, Heritage, Boston College and Old Dominion.

Heritage’s Donovan Raikes scored 20 points and Ramone Green had 17 as their team joined King’s Fork in the state tournament. Daron Baugh led Hampton with 19 points and Jaylen Wynn had 14.

Class 3 Region A Tournament Lake Taylor 71, Booker T. Washington 50:

Elijah Washington, Aaron Elliott and Rodney Baines finished with double-doubles as the Titans beat their Eastern District rival in a quarterfin­al.

Washington had 19 points and 18 rebounds along with three blocked shots, while Baines added 12 points and 14 boards and Elliott chipped in 14 points and 10 assists. The Bookers’ Triston Skipwith also had 10 points.

Lafayette 62, Phoebus 55 (OT): The Rams finally pulled away in overtime after the teams were tied at halftime and the end of regulation.

Lafayette will play Lake Taylor in a 7 p.m. semifinal Saturday at Scope.

Petersburg 89, New Kent 70: The host Crimson Wave outscored the Trojans 21-12 to finish the first half ahead 48-35.

Hopewell 90, Colonial Heights 46: Top-seeded Hopewell dominated the Colonials, so the Blue Devils and Crimson Wave, who are longtime rivals south of Richmond, will play in the other semifinal at Scope for a state berth.

Girls Class 3 Region A Tournament Lakeland 56, Lake Taylor 41:

Janae Carter’s 16 points led the Cavaliers, who rallied to earn a semifinal matchup against top-seeded Hopewell at 1 p.m. Saturday at Scope.

Lakeland trailed 35-33 to start the fourth quarter, but used a 12-3 spurt in the first five minutes of the final period to take control.

The Cavaliers’ Nyeshia Savage finished with 12 points and 14 rebounds, Jaelyn Brown had 11 points and Ja’Najah Artis had seven points and dished out 12 assists.

Hopewell 54, Booker T. Washington 14: The host Blue Devils ousted the Bookers. Erin Edmonds had 25 points, seven rebounds and four assists and Amiya Reese-Banks and Keeniya Kelley had 10 points apiece for Hopewell.

Norcom 72, York 39: Alaijah Kirk-Veal paced the Greyhounds with 20 points, Shamyah Price added 17 and Jesu Salinas finished with 16.

The Greyhounds (18-6) will face Lafayette in a semifinal at Scope at 3 p.m. Saturday.

Lafayette 43, Tabb 31: Alexis Blake (11 points, 10 rebounds) and Alexis Foster (10 points) led the Rams (18-6) past the Tigers in a clash of Bay Rivers District teams.

Private schools Pathways (Florida) 67, Veritas Collegiate Academy 64:

Playing in the National Associatio­n of Christian Athletes tournament in Dayton, Tennessee, the Chesapeake-based Spartans lost to an opponent from Orlando.

Koren Jones led Veritas with 23 points, Stephon Cherry had 13, Savon Saniford 12 and Majesty Dawson 11.
